theres many programs out there you just gotta find them on google. theres roger wilco, teamspeak, ventrilo(i think thats it), um and a whole lot of other ones. my favorite is teamspeak now. i used roger wilco for a long time but then i switched to teamspeak and noticed that the sound clarity is allot better. try them all if you wanna see which is best.
